Where is ELCB Installed?

Published in Electrical Safety Devices 3 mins read

The Earth Leakage Circuit Breaker (ELCB) is primarily installed at the customer's electrical circuit, typically within the main distribution board or consumer unit of a premises. Its installation is often mandated by regulatory authorities to ensure electrical safety.

Exact Location and Regulatory Mandate

As per directives from bodies like the Central Electricity Authority (CEA) and the Delhi Electricity Regulatory Commission (DERC), ELCBs are a mandatory inclusion in a consumer's electrical system. This means you will find them integrated into the main electrical panel where the power supply first enters a building, whether it's a home, office, or commercial establishment.

The specific instruction from the reference states: "As per the mandate by CEA and DERC, ELCB has to be installed at customer's electrical circuit along with MCB's." This highlights its placement at the initial point of the customer's wiring, ensuring comprehensive protection for all downstream circuits from the risk of earth leakage.

Role Alongside MCBs

The reference also specifies that the ELCB is installed "along with MCBs" (Miniature Circuit Breakers). While both are crucial for electrical safety, they serve distinct and complementary purposes:

  • ELCB (Earth Leakage Circuit Breaker): Primarily designed to detect and protect against earth leakage currents. These are small, unwanted currents that flow to the earth, often due to insulation failure or accidental contact, which can cause severe electric shocks or even fatal electrocution. The ELCB quickly trips, cutting off the power supply and preventing harm.
  • MCB (Miniature Circuit Breaker): Protects against overcurrents (when too much current flows through a circuit) and short circuits (an abnormal connection between two points of a circuit that are intended to be at different voltages). MCBs prevent damage to appliances, wiring, and reduce the risk of electrical fires.

Their co-location ensures a robust safety system: MCBs protect the circuit and appliances from damage, while ELCBs specifically protect human life from electric shocks.
